The Royal Burgh of Haddington is a sought-after and historic market town in picturesque East Lothian, eighteen miles east of Edinburgh City Centre. Situated on the banks of the River Tyne and surrounded by beautiful countryside, there are many outdoor recreational pursuits to enjoy including pleasant walks and cycles. The local Farmers Market is a monthly delight with a variety of local seasonal produce on offer. The town itself has popular tennis, rugby, and bowling clubs, along with a sports centre with a swimming pool, gym, sports hall, and health suite. The town's thriving High Street and main thoroughfare provides excellent daily shopping options from bakeries and cafés to convenience stores and a Tesco supermarket. The retail park, which is within walking distance of the property offers an Aldi, Home Bargain store, Costa Coffee amongst others. World renowned golf courses and stunning sandy beaches can be easily accessed making Haddington a popular location for families and golfers alike. Well-regarded local schooling includes Haddington Primary School and Knox Academy. Private schooling is available at The Compass School in Haddington, which is a short walk away from 9 Station Avenue, Belhaven Hill in Dunbar, and Loretto in Musselburgh, as well as a variety of choices in Edinburgh. Haddington is a ten-minute drive to Drem train station which has a regular service between Edinburgh and North Berwick. There is easy access to Edinburgh by car, and bus, as well as to the A1 and City Bypass.
